ecs.t6-c1m2.large 是阿里云(Aliyun)ECS(弹性计算服务)的一种实例类型,属于 突发性能型 实例。这种类型的实例适用于那些 CPU 使用率通常较低、但偶尔需要突发 CPU 性能的应用场景。
一、关于 ecs.t6-c1m2.large 的基本参数
- CPU: 1 核
- 内存: 2 GiB
- 适用场景: 轻量级应用、小型网站、开发测试环境等
- 特点:
- 属于 t6 系列
- 使用 CPU 积分机制:持续低负载运行时积累积分,高负载时消耗积分来提升性能
- 成本较低,适合预算有限的项目
二、是否适合运行 Docker?
是的,可以在 ecs.t6-c1m2.large 上运行 Docker,但需要注意以下几点:
✅ 优点:
- 可以运行轻量级容器化应用(如 Nginx、小型数据库、微服务测试)
- 搭配 Docker Compose 可部署多个服务
- 适合用于学习、测试、演示环境
❗️限制:
- 资源有限:仅 1 核 CPU 和 2GB 内存,不适合部署多个或资源密集型服务
- 性能瓶颈:如果运行 MySQL、Redis 等数据库类服务,可能会出现性能问题
- CPU 积分机制:长时间高负载可能导致 CPU 被限制
三、使用建议
🛠 如果你想在该 ECS 上运行 Docker:
-
安装 Docker:
sudo yum install -y yum-utils sudo yum-config-manager --add-repo https://download.docker.com/linux/centos/docker-ce.repo sudo yum install -y docker-ce docker-ce-cli containerd.io sudo systemctl start docker sudo systemctl enable docker -
运行一个简单容器测试:
docker run -d -p 80:80 nginx -
监控资源使用情况:
top free -h docker stats -
考虑使用 swap 分区(防止内存不足)
四、是否推荐用于生产?
不推荐将 ecs.t6-c1m2.large 用于生产环境,尤其是:
- 需要稳定性能的服务(如数据库、API 后端)
- 多个服务同时运行
- 高并发访问场景
如果你有生产需求,建议选择更高配置的 ECS 实例,例如:
- 通用型 g6/g7/g8
- 计算型 c6/c7
- 内存型 r6/r7
五、替代方案建议
如果你只是想低成本运行 Docker 应用,可以考虑:
| 方案 | 说明 |
|---|---|
| 阿里云轻量应用服务器 | 更便宜,更适合小型应用部署 |
| 多容器共享资源 | 使用 Docker Compose 编排多个轻量服务 |
| Kubernetes + K3s | 在小资源机器上部署轻量 Kubernetes |
六、总结
| 项目 | 是否支持 |
|---|---|
| 运行 Docker | ✅ 支持 |
| 适合生产? | ❌ 不推荐 |
| 适合用途 | ✅ 测试 / 学习 / Demo |
| 资源是否充足 | ⚠️ 仅限轻量服务 |
如果你告诉我你要部署什么服务(比如 WordPress、Node.js、Python 应用),我可以进一步帮你判断这个配置是否合适。
云知识